Subject: [PATCH v3 4/5] arm64: dts: qcom: sa8775p: add UFS nodes
Date: Tue, 11 Apr 2023 15:04:45 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230411130446.401440-5-brgl@bgdev.pl>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230411130446.401440-1-brgl@bgdev.pl>

From: Bartosz Golaszewski <bartosz.golaszewski@linaro.org>

Add nodes for the UFS and its PHY on sa8775p platforms.

Signed-off-by: Bartosz Golaszewski <bartosz.golaszewski@linaro.org>
Reviewed-by: Konrad Dybcio <konrad.dybcio@linaro.org>
---
 ar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sa8775p.dtsi | 58 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 58 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sa8775p.dtsi b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sa8775p.dtsi
index 2343df7e0ea4..5de0fbbe9752 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sa8775p.dtsi
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sa8775p.dtsi
@@ -585,6 +585,64 @@ &clk_virt SLAVE_QUP_CORE_1 QCOM_ICC_TAG_ALWAYS>,
 			};
 		};
 
+		ufs_mem_hc: ufs@1d84000 {
+			compatible = "qcom,sa8775p-ufshc", "qcom,ufshc", "jedec,ufs-2.0";
+			reg = <0x0 0x01d84000 0x0 0x3000>;
+			interrupts = <GIC_SPI 265 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>;
+			phys = <&ufs_mem_phy>;
+			phy-names = "ufsphy";
+			lanes-per-direction = <2>;
+			#reset-cells = <1>;
+			resets = <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_BCR>;
+			reset-names = "rst";
+			power-domains = <&gcc UFS_PHY_GDSC>;
+			required-opps = <&rpmhpd_opp_nom>;
+			iommus = <&apps_smmu 0x100 0x0>;
+			clocks = <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_AXI_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_AGGRE_UFS_PHY_AXI_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_AHB_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_UNIPRO_CORE_CLK>,
+				 <&rpmhcc RPMH_CXO_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_TX_SYMBOL_0_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_RX_SYMBOL_0_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_RX_SYMBOL_1_CLK>;
+			clock-names = "core_clk",
+				      "bus_aggr_clk",
+				      "iface_clk",
+				      "core_clk_unipro",
+				      "ref_clk",
+				      "tx_lane0_sync_clk",
+				      "rx_lane0_sync_clk",
+				      "rx_lane1_sync_clk";
+			freq-table-hz = <75000000 300000000>,
+					<0 0>,
+					<0 0>,
+					<75000000 300000000>,
+					<0 0>,
+					<0 0>,
+					<0 0>,
+					<0 0>;
+			status = "disabled";
+		};
+
+		ufs_mem_phy: phy@1d87000 {
+			compatible = "qcom,sa8775p-qmp-ufs-phy";
+			reg = <0x0 0x01d87000 0x0 0xe10>;
+			/*
+			 * Yes, GCC_EDP_REF_CLKREF_EN is correct in qref. It
+			 * enables the CXO clock to eDP *and* UFS PHY.
+			 */
+			clocks = <&rpmhcc RPMH_CXO_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_UFS_PHY_PHY_AUX_CLK>,
+				 <&gcc GCC_EDP_REF_CLKREF_EN>;
+			clock-names = "ref", "ref_aux", "qref";
+			power-domains = <&gcc UFS_PHY_GDSC>;
+			resets = <&ufs_mem_hc 0>;
+			reset-names = "ufsphy";
+			#phy-cells = <0>;
+			status = "disabled";
+		};
+
 		tcsr_mutex: hwlock@1f40000 {
 			compatible = "qcom,tcsr-mutex";
 			reg = <0x0 0x01f40000 0x0 0x20000>;
